On-hold due to bad weather...
The plan was to set out today for the end of the Clyde Inlet, but bad weather has set in and we'll be staying put until at least Sunday most likely.
Wind: 22 mph (40 km/h) gusting to 37 mph (60 km/h)Snow (expected): .8in (2 cm)
Temp: 36 deg F (3.7 deg C)
**Wind and snow/rain Increasing throughout the day The weather would be "manageable" for now, but with the length of the trip to the end of the inlet we would be in for some nasty weather before the end. Tommy's advice is king in this situation and I am in no hurry now that I am here. I am planning on heading out this afternoon though and hiking to the large bluff to the southeast of Clyde River. I'll bring my camping kit and camp there until this weather clears and we can head out. I am afraid I'll get soft sitting here waiting for it to pass. Updates will most likely be from my tent starting later today - a good opportunity to test out my gear from this latitude. Thanks for tuning in...
